- Dr. Andre K.W. Tan - Head and
Chief of Service
Dr. Andre Tan graduated from Johns Hopkins
University, Baltimore, Maryland, USA in 1985 with a Bachelor of
Science in Biomedical Engineering with concentration in Material
Science and Engineering. He obtained his M.D. degree at McGill
University, Montreal, PQ, Canada in 1989. He then completed his
Otolaryngology training at McGill University in 1994 followed
by a year of fellowship in Facial Plastic and Reconstructive Surgery
at the University of Toronto / American Academy of Facial Plastic
and Reconstructive Surgery. He obtained his FRCSC in Otolaryngolgy
in 1995.
He arrived at Queen's University, Department
of Otolaryngology in November 1995 with the appointment of Assistant
Professor in the School of Medicine.
Dr. Tan's clinical interests include:
- General Otolaryngology
- Facial Plastic and Reconstructive Surgery
- Rhinology.
Research interests include:
- Fetal wound healing
- Spousal abuse - Domestic violence research
& education
- Otoacoustic Emission
- Laryngeal imaging for laryngopharyngeal
reflux
- Complications of carbon dioxide laser
resurfacing procedures
Currently, Dr. Tan is involved with the
following research projects:
- Fetal wound healing
- Exposure to domestic violence and attitudes
towards learning
- Habitual snoring and noise induced hearing
loss
